The Breakdown: How Much Does Market Research Cost in Nigeria?

The cost of market research in Nigeria can range from ₦350,000 (approximately $500) for micro-projects to over ₦25,000,000 (approximately $35,000) for large-scale, multi-year feasibility studies. To understand this spectrum, let’s look at the market segmentation.

1. Freelance and Basic Research Packages

On the lower end of the spectrum, businesses might consider freelance researchers. Platforms like Upwork host Nigerian researchers offering basic packages starting from around $410 for a starter report, which might include competitive analysis and basic market trends, delivered in about 10 days . Freelancers on platforms like Guru may charge as low as $500 for specific data collection tasks .

However, while these options are budget-friendly, they often lack the depth required for regulatory approvals, bank loan applications, or large-scale investor pitches. They are best suited for very small businesses needing quick, surface-level insights.

2. Specialized and Full-Scale Feasibility Reports

For businesses requiring robust documentation—such as a bankable feasibility report—the investment is significantly higher. International strategy firms operating in Nigeria often price comprehensive feasibility studies in specific industries at a premium. For example, a detailed feasibility study for the cement, lime, and plaster products industry can be priced as high as €34,999 (approximately ₦58 million) . This price point usually includes extensive financial modeling for 15-25 years, detailed legal feasibility, and exhaustive market analysis .

3. Specialized Services: Mystery Shopping and Opinion Polling

Beyond desktop research, there are costs associated with primary data collection. If you need to understand employee behavior or customer service standards, Mystery Shopping is the tool. In Nigeria, this involves hiring trained individuals to pose as customers to evaluate service, compliance, and experience . The cost here depends on the number of “shops” (visits), the type (in-person, phone, digital), and the complexity of the report.

Similarly, Opinion Polling is vital for political campaigns, brand perception studies, and social research. The cost varies based on sample size and geographical spread.

Factors Influencing the Cost of Market Research

Understanding the “why” behind the price helps you budget better. Here are the primary factors that drive the cost of hiring a market research company in Nigeria:

1. Scope and Methodology

Is the research limited to Lagos, or does it cover all 36 states? Are you using surveys (quantitative) or focus groups (qualitative)? Quantitative research involving a large sample size requires more enumerators, data entry clerks, and analysts, driving up costs. As noted in the industry, services like “Store Check” and “Competitive Product Shopping” require boots on the ground, which involves logistics and personnel costs .

2. The Complexity of Data Analysis

Raw data is useless without interpretation. The cost of your project includes the expertise of statisticians and analysts who use advanced tools to spot trends. For instance, a TAM (Total Addressable Market) Calculation or complex SWOT analysis requires senior-level oversight .

4. Deliverables and Customization

A standard 15-page report will cost less than a 50-page custom strategy document complete with investor pitch decks. If you need a business plan that aligns with the specific formatting requirements of the Bank of Industry (BOI) or the Central Bank of Nigeria (CBN), this requires customization, which adds value—and cost.

Conclusion: Budgeting for Success

So, how much should you budget? For a standard Small or Medium Enterprise (SME) looking for a robust business plan or feasibility report in Nigeria, you should expect to invest anywhere from ₦500,000 to ₦5,000,000, depending on the complexity and scale. For large corporations requiring full-scale market entry studies with national polling, the investment will be higher.
